Konvertieren von MySQL zu MySQLi: Eine Anleitung zum Migrieren Ihres Codes
Aufgrund der veralteten Version von MySQL ist es wichtig, ein Upgrade auf MySQLi durchzuführen beste Datenbankinteraktionserfahrung. Obwohl dieser Übergang entmutigend erscheinen mag, insbesondere bei einer großen Codebasis, die MySQL verwendet, stellen wir Ihnen eine ausführliche Erklärung zur Verfügung, damit Sie die Konvertierung mühelos durchführen können.
Eine häufige Aufgabe bei der Arbeit mit Datenbanken ist das Abfragen von Daten. Hier ist ein Beispiel einer in MySQL geschriebenen SQL-Abfrage:
$sql_follows = "SELECT * FROM friends WHERE user1_id=" . $_SESSION['id'] . " AND status=2 OR user2_id=" . $_SESSION['id'] . " AND status=2";
Um diese Abfrage in MySQLi zu konvertieren, können Sie die folgenden Schritte ausführen:
$connection = mysqli_connect("localhost", "username", "password", "database_name");
$query = "SELECT * FROM friends WHERE user1_id=? AND status=? OR user2_id=? AND status=?";
$stmt = mysqli_prepare($connection, $query); mysqli_stmt_bind_param($stmt, 'iiii', $_SESSION['id'], 2, $_SESSION['id'], 2);
mysqli_stmt_execute($stmt);
$result = mysqli_stmt_get_result($stmt); while ($row = mysqli_fetch_array($result, MYSQLI_ASSOC)) { // Process row data }
Zusätzliche Tools:
Indem Sie diese Schritte befolgen und die bereitgestellten Ressourcen nutzen, können Sie Ihren Code effektiv von MySQL nach MySQLi konvertieren und so Kompatibilität und verbesserte Datenbankleistung gewährleisten für Ihre Bewerbung.
Das obige ist der detaillierte Inhalt vonSo migrieren Sie Ihren Code von MySQL nach MySQLi: Eine Schritt-für-Schritt-Anleitung.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!